在Windows本地搭建MySQL教程

1. 整体流程

首先,我们来整理一下在Windows本地搭建MySQL的整体流程,可以使用表格展示步骤如下:

步骤 描述
1 下载MySQL安装包
2 安装MySQL
3 配置MySQL
4 启动MySQL服务
5 连接MySQL数据库

接下来,我们将逐步介绍每个步骤需要执行的操作和代码。

2. 下载MySQL安装包

首先,你需要从MySQL官方网站(

3. 安装MySQL

安装MySQL非常简单,只需按照安装向导提示进行操作即可。

4. 配置MySQL

安装完成后,我们需要进行一些MySQL的配置。

首先,打开MySQL的配置文件my.ini,可以在安装目录下找到。找到以下内容,并进行相应修改:

[mysqld]
basedir=C:/mysql   # MySQL安装目录
datadir=C:/mysql/data   # MySQL数据存储目录
port=3306   # MySQL服务监听的端口号

接下来,我们设置MySQL的环境变量。在系统环境变量中,找到Path变量,将MySQL的bin目录路径添加到Path变量中,以便我们可以在命令行中直接使用MySQL命令。

5. 启动MySQL服务

在命令行中输入以下命令启动MySQL服务:

> net start mysql

如果一切正常,你将看到类似以下的输出:

MySQL 服务正在启动 ..
MySQL 服务已经启动成功。

6. 连接MySQL数据库

现在,我们已经成功搭建了MySQL本地环境,可以连接到数据库并进行操作。

在命令行中输入以下命令连接到MySQL数据库:

> mysql -u root -p

其中,-u参数指定用户名,这里使用root作为示例;-p参数表示需要输入密码。

输入正确的密码后,你将看到MySQL命令行提示符,表示已成功连接到MySQL数据库。

7. 创建和操作数据库

现在,你可以在MySQL命令行中执行SQL语句来创建和操作数据库了。

下面是一些常用的MySQL命令:

  • 创建数据库:
CREATE DATABASE database_name;
  • 切换到指定数据库:
USE database_name;
  • 创建表:
CREATE TABLE table_name (
    column1 datatype,
    column2 datatype,
    column3 datatype,
    ...
);
  • 插入数据:
IN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);
  • 查询数据:
SELECT * FROM table_name;
  • 更新数据:
UPDATE table_name
SET column1 = value1, column2 = value2, ...
WHERE condition;
  • 删除数据:
DELETE FROM table_name WHERE condition;

甘特图

下面是一个使用mermaid语法绘制的甘特图,展示了整个搭建MySQL的流程及时间:

gantt
    title MySQL本地搭建甘特图

    section 下载安装
    下载安装     : 2021-01-01, 1d

    section 配置MySQL
    配置MySQL     : 2021-01-02, 2d

    section 启动服务
    启动服务     : 2021-01-04, 1d

    section 连接数据库
    连接数据库     : 2021-01-05, 1d

    section 操作数据库
    操作数据库     : 2021-01-06, 3d

以上就是在Windows本地搭建MySQL的详细步骤和代码说明。希望对你有帮助!